Once the Control Center is on the watch screen, simply tap on the iPhone icon and, in a flash, you'll hear your iPhone pinging (if it is nearby and the battery hasn't died). Follow the source of the sound and you will soon see your handset. It is a quick and simple way to find a missing iPhone.
Apple decided to promote this feature in its latest ad for the device, although it might also be considered an Apple Watch ad. The 60-second commercial, which will probably be edited to create a 30-second spot as well, starts by showing off a two-lane road in the country. We also see a truck being driven by a crusty old farmer traveling with a dog sitting beside him. He looks like he is trying to remember where he has been as he shifts the truck to reverse.
Spotting a haystack, he drives off the road and onto a field with his trusty canine at his side. The dog walks over to the haystack and starts barking. After staring at the haystack, the farmer rolls up his sleeve to reveal his Apple Watch. We see him tap his Apple Watch and instantly the pinging starts. Reaching blindly into the haystack, the cowboy finds his iPhone and we have a happy ending.
And as the iPhone is placed in its owner's back pocket, up comes the tagline: "Relax, it's iPhone +Apple Watch."
